Output e5650358c52656c98d89139795e18af56ec539e1f9228abcf62609aa5836fba9:1

value
35319000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b57ebb115ffcd3ec6e337632f22f30c753c6c3e OP_EQUAL
address
MLbwUvtWqs5d4fvovupf4nkLcDAmus2Gwf
transaction
e5650358c52656c98d89139795e18af56ec539e1f9228abcf62609aa5836fba9
spent
true